It looks like one of Mark Hughes’ first acts as Man City manager will be to rubber stamp the exit of this truly rancid striker.
If reports are to be believed, Man City are set to bite Gordon Strachan’s wee hand off as he offers 3 million quid for Greek tragedy Georgios Samaras, a main who lowered the bar so much at Eastlands that said bar is now somewhere in Australia.

Celtic are set to offer a staggering £3 million for misfit striker Georgios Samaras, according to reports.

The former Heerenveen man is also thought to be attracting interest from Italy in the shape of Lecce and Lazio, while Werder Bremen have also been monitoring his situation.

Signed for almost £6 million by Stuart Pearce, the Greek has rarely impressed at Eastlands and new boss Mark Hughes seems certain to offload the striker as he gets his rebuilding plans underway. (Blue View)

So before Samaras does leave for Celtic on a permanent basis we have to ask; are there any City fans who rated him?
